BizFed Connects with LA County Freshman Legislators

With this year's unprecedented turnover in LA County's state legislative delegation (13 Assembly and 2 Senate), BizFed held its first-ever special breakfast reception Feb. 22 for freshman state legislators to connect them with active business leaders from their districts and throughout the region.

LA County Economic Outlook: Modest

Los Angeles County's economy will continue to improve this year and next, with unemployment expected to drop below 10 percent by 2014, coupled with modest gains in job creation, the Los Angeles Economic Development Corporation said in a new forecast report. But forecasters warned that Los Angeles County's nonfarm employment numbers likely won't match their 2007 peak until 2015 or 2016.

LA City Forming Economic Development Department

The LA City Council voted on Feb. 5 to advance a proposal to create a new Economic Development Department to improve private sector job creation and economic development services and activities in the City. Numerous business organizations - including BizFed - are engaged in working to develop a solid foundation for the department.

Go-Biz Hosting Manufacturing Summit March 27

The Governor’s Office for Business and Economic Development (GO-Biz) will hold an advanced Manufacturing Summit at the Capitol on March 27th, 2013. The summit will be led by Governor Brown’s Senior Jobs Advisor Mike Rossi and will convene key stakeholders from education, industry, research and the state’s iHub innovation network.
